> >> > A small wart in this API is the meaning of
> >> >
> >> >   shuffle(a, independent=False, axis=None)
> >> >
> >> > It could be argued that the correct behavior is to leave the
> >> > array unchanged. (The current behavior can be interpreted as
> >> > shuffling a 1-d sequence of monolithic blobs; the axis argument
> >> > specifies which axis of the array corresponds to the
> >> > sequence index.  Then `axis=None` means the argument is
> >> > a single monolithic blob, so there is nothing to shuffle.)
> >> > Or an error could be raised.
> >> >
> >> > What do you think?
> >>
> >> It seems to me a perfectly good reason to have two methods instead of
> >> one. I can't imagine when I wouldn't be using a literal True or False
> >> for this, so it really should be two different methods.

> >> That said, I would just make the axis=None behavior the same for both
> >> methods. axis=None does *not* mean "treat this like a single
> >> monolithic blob" in any of the axis=-having methods; it means "flatten
> >> the array and do the operation on the single flattened axis". I think
> >> the latter behavior is a reasonable interpretation of axis=None for
> >> both methods.
